Really enjoyed downtown Sat. night. Good weather. Crowds everywhere. The doors opened at 6:30 for the 8:00 concert. Since we hadn't finished exploring the new arena and couldn't know when other people would head downtown, we arrived around 5:30 and parked between Main and Market on a side street. $.50 toward a meter. Walked a few blocks, instead of a parking garage for $10. May not always be able to do that but we like walking downtown anyway.
Crowds everywhere. Waits at restaurants on either side of the arena were 1 1/2 to 2 hours. We thought it would be crazy and had a snack at home but knew we could get a BBC beer. Stood outside and people watched.
The arena and the Eagles were wonderful. The sound was amazing. The simple backshots on the stage were great. Hotel California was a great visual. Woodford on the rocks, $6.75. Had been $4.75 at Freedom Hall. We didn't eat anything there or have too much more to drink. It costs too much to get in there to spend too much money.
Afterwards, headed back to BBC where Brad found an outside table and got loaner Warthog mugs for us. Had nachos, then headed inside to finish the beers. It was getting chilly.
Walking west on Main, there weren't too many people left, but it was after midnight.
Scrimmage, then MMJ, then exhibition games, then into the regular season for men and women's basketball. It so good to have an option before and/or after the game/concert instead of Freedom Hall fare only.
